RAMALLAH: The country is gradually being affected today by a low-pressure system accompanied by a very cold air mass. Consequently, the weather becomes rainy and very cold, with heavy rains accompanied by thunderstorms and occasional hail, according to the Palestine Meteorological Department. Winds blow from the southwest and northwest, are active in speed, with strong gusts at times. During the evening and night hours, the weather will remain intensely cold and rainy, with heavy rains accompanied by thunderstorms and hail. Tomorrow, Monday, the influence of the low-pressure system is expected to persist across the country, leading to cold to very cold and rainy weather. The rains are likely to be heavy, accompanied by thunderstorms and occasional hail. On Tuesday, the impact of the low-pressure system is predicted to continue, resulting in rainy and intensely cold weather. Heavy rains, thunderstorms, and occasional hail are expected. Next Wednesday, the influence of the low-pressure system are expected t o deepen, leading to rainy and cold to very cold weather. Heavy rains, accompanied by thunderstorms and occasional hail, are expected. People are warned about the danger of flash floods in valleys and low-lying areas, the high speed of the winds, the risk of sliding on roads, and reduced horizontal visibility.
